== Other uses == [[ISO 8601]] includes a [[ISO week date|specification]] for a 52/53-week year. Any year that has 53 Thursdays has 53 weeks; this extra week may be regarded as intercalary. The ''xiuhpōhualli'' (year count) system of the [[Aztec calendar]] had five intercalary days after the eighteenth and final month, the ''[[nēmontēmi]]'', in which the people fasted and reflected on the past year.
